Upload content from a remote source (S3, GCS, SharePoint, GitHub) to the knowledge base. Content is processed asynchronously in the background.
Bearer authentication header of the form Bearer <token>, where <token> is your auth token.
Database ID to use for content storage
ID of the configured remote content source (from /knowledge/config)
Path to file or folder in the remote source
Content name (auto-generated if not provided)
Content description
JSON metadata object
ID of the reader to use for processing
Chunking strategy to apply
Chunk size for processing
Chunk overlap for processing
Remote content upload accepted for processing
Unique identifier for the content
Name of the content
Description of the content
MIME type of the content
Size of the content in bytes
ID of related content if linked
Additional metadata as key-value pairs
Number of times content has been accessed
x >= 0Processing status of the content
processing, completed, failed Status message or error details
Timestamp when content was created
Timestamp when content was last updated